Output e34d8ea342a737b06e62cc07a4e8323408fa32aae78ffbb80305cd35ba84669b:0
- value
- 10617543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aa9d1bc879efd5bedb850a0fe8d3f3276b027df OP_EQUAL
- address
- 38VoMzN5cLAVnin8riX5c97jeQ9SwNjrj4
- transaction
- e34d8ea342a737b06e62cc07a4e8323408fa32aae78ffbb80305cd35ba84669b
- confirmations
- 306227
- spent
- true